¿Sabías que las tertulias de Nava eran el círculo de intelectuales ilustrados más importantes de #LaLaguna? @turismolalaguna Estas ilustres tertulias se realizaban en el colindante Palacio de Nava. Desde su creación por Tomás de Nava-Grimón y Porlier hasta su apogeo vivido gracias a su hijo Alonso de Nava y Grimón, la reunión aglutinó a grandes personalidades de Canarias y de otros lugares. 🎫 🏛️ History & Architecture

The Palacio de Nava showcases architecture from the late 16th century, with significant modifications in the mid-17th century and a complete rebuild in 1776 by Tomás de Nava y Grimón y Porlier, giving it its present appearance. :building_construction:

Historically, the palace was a significant meeting point for intellectuals during the Enlightenment, hosting important gatherings known as the 'tertulias de Nava'. :bulb:

Architectural Significance and Historical Context

The Palacio de Nava stands as a notable example of historical architecture in La Laguna. Originally constructed in the late 16th century, it underwent substantial modifications in the mid-17th century. The most significant transformation occurred in 1776 when Tomás de Nava y Grimón y Porlier completely rebuilt the structure, giving it the appearance it largely retains today. This architectural evolution reflects the changing styles and needs of its prominent owners over centuries. Instagram

Beyond its physical structure, the palace holds considerable historical weight. It was famously the venue for the 'tertulias de Nava,' intellectual salons that were among the most important circles of enlightened thinkers in La Laguna. These gatherings fostered significant cultural and philosophical exchange, cementing the palace's reputation as a center of knowledge and debate during the Enlightenment period. Instagram
